The positive economic development in Frankfurt am Main has continued without interruption in 217, with falling unemployment and a growing number of employees that are subject to social insurance contributions. The rate of unemployment stood at 5.8 % in May 217 and therefore fell a further.5 % points compared to the previous year. In addition, the number of employees subject to social insurance contributions increased by 2.2 % to 559,563 based on the latest available data to 3 September 216. The Regional Statistical Office for Hesse also reported (price-adjusted) GDP growth of 1.5 % for 216. Significant boosts to the economy were provided by the construction industry with 8.1 % growth, as well as the retail, transport, hotel and restaurant, information and communication sector with growth of 2.9 % compared to the previous year. Office-related industry sectors also presented themselves in a positive light. The economic survey carried out by the Frankfurt Chamber of Industry and Commerce (IHK) in early summer showed that 95 % of all companies within the finance, credit, and insurance sector rated their business situation as good or satisfactory. Assessments of future business prospects were equally positive, with 91 % of companies expecting their situation to improve or remain the same. Among business service providers, 93 % rated their situation as the same or good, while 92 % had unchanged or increasing expectations for the future.

From April to June, space take-up by tenants and owner-occupiers reached 123,8 sqm and thus exceeded the year-ago level by 22.8 %. In the first half of 217, space take-up amounted to 248,3 sqm in total. This not only surpassed the same period of 216 by 12.6 %, but also beat the average for the last 1 years by 15.7 %. Most size categories were affected by this strong take-up growth. Only the 2,51-5, sqm and 1, sqm plus segments registered a reduction in volumes compared to the previous year. The remaining categories recorded growth rates of between 2.8 % and 91.3 %. The number of deals also increased. This was especially the case in the 5, - 1, sqm segment, where contracts more than doubled from four in 216 to nine in the current year. Law firm Clifford Chance leased around 11,8 sqm on JunghofPlaza in the banking district (Bankenviertel). In addition, Axa Versicherung signed a contract for 8, sqm in a project development at 316 Berliner Straße in the Offenbach- Kaiserlei sub-market. The third-largest deal in the quarter also took place in the banking district and saw the Bundesbank extend its existing space in Trianon by a further 7, sqm. As a result of the large contract signings, banks, financial services and insurances retained the number one spot in the industry ranking. This group accounted for take-up of 43,2 sqm or a share of 17.4 %. Consulting, marketing and research occupied second position with 14.3 % or 35,5 sqm, while communications & IT accounted for 3,8 sqm or 12.4 % of the volume. The CBD remained the most popular location for office users and increased its market share significantly from 51.3 % in the previous year to 6.9 %. In terms of the individual sub-markets, the banking district was still the dominant area with 47,7 sqm of take-up, ahead of Westend with 31,1 sqm and the station district (Bahnhofsviertel) with 21,5 sqm. Large-scale and expensive lease contracts in the banking district and Westend pushed up the space-weighted average rent from 19.3/sqm in the previous quarter to 19.5/sqm in the second quarter of 217. The prime rent was unchanged at 39./sqm.

However, space removals reached a higher volume of 78,8 sqm, of which almost 6 % was converted into residential space. As a result, total office stock declined to million sqm. In the April to June period, market-active vacancies on the Frankfurt market for office space that is, office space that can be occupied within three months of the contract signing fell markedly for the fourth time in succession. At the end of the second quarter, some million sqm of office space was available at short notice. The resulting vacancy rate of 1. % has therefore declined by a further.4 %-points within the last three months. The positive development in the first half of 217 combined with upcoming lettings also point to an equally good performance in the second half of 217. Furthermore, the first contracts to be signed as a result of Brexit are expected to take place this year, triggering additional take-up. A double-digit number of banks have already cited Frankfurt as a future location. The take-up this year could exceed 55, sqm. Consequently, vacancies will also continue to fall and rents continue to rise. Outlook next 12 months Office stock % Vacancy Take-up Prime rent Average rent $ $ % Source: NAI apolloreal estate
